Commercial roof inspection services involve a thorough examination of a building’s roofing system to assess its current condition. Skilled service providers evaluate the roof’s surface for signs of damage, wear, or deterioration, including cracks, leaks, ponding water, or damaged flashing. These inspections often include checking the roof’s drainage systems, insulation, and structural components to identify potential issues before they develop into costly repairs. Regular inspections help property owners maintain the integrity of their roofs, extend their lifespan, and avoid unexpected problems that could disrupt business operations or lead to significant expenses.

The primary goal of a commercial roof inspection is to detect problems early, such as leaks, membrane damage, or areas of compromised insulation. Identifying these issues promptly can prevent water intrusion, mold growth, or structural damage that might threaten the safety of the building and its occupants. Inspections also serve to verify whether recent repairs or maintenance efforts have been effective. For property owners, especially those managing large office buildings, retail centers, warehouses, or industrial facilities, these services provide peace of mind by ensuring the roof remains in sound condition and helps avoid emergency repairs that can disrupt daily activities.

The overview below groups typical Commercial Roof Inspection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- typical costs for routine roof inspections and minor repairs range from $250-$600. Many projects in this category are straightforward and fall within the middle of this range, with fewer reaching the higher end.

Major Repairs - larger repair jobs, such as fixing extensive damage or leaks, often cost between $600-$2,000. These projects are common but tend to stay within this middle band, with some exceeding it for complex issues.

Full Roof Inspection - comprehensive assessments usually cost $300-$800, depending on the size and complexity of the roof. Most inspections land in this range, with occasional higher costs for larger or more detailed evaluations.

Full Roof Replacement - complete roof replacements typically cost $5,000-$15,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ects can reach $20,000+, but many standard replacements fall within the lower to mid-range of this spectrum.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is a commercial roof inspection? A commercial roof inspection involves a thorough assessment of a building's roof to identify potential issues, damage, or areas needing maintenance, helping to prevent costly repairs in the future.

Why should a business consider regular roof inspections? Regular inspections can detect early signs of damage or deterioration, ensuring the roof remains in good condition and avoiding unexpected failures that could disrupt operations.

What types of issues can a commercial roof inspection uncover? Inspections can reveal problems such as leaks, membrane damage, ponding water, loose flashing, or structural weaknesses that may not be immediately visible.

Who can perform a commercial roof inspection? Local contractors experienced in commercial roofing can handle inspections, providing professional evaluations to help maintain the roof’s integrity.

How can a business benefit from a professional roof inspection? A professional inspection can help extend the roof’s lifespan, identify maintenance needs early, and support informed decisions about repairs or replacements.
